to see the line up at 2:30 (when we’d FINALLY got up the M2, parked up and got to the ground) just proved that we really do have a good squad. Even with a few injuries at the moment.

I enjoyed the first half. Both teams testing each other a little. Nothing clear cut for either side. Fletcher had a good chance for them, we had a good long ranger from someone (maybe Coleman??).

Second half we really stepped up a gear. The goal was Tim Diengs, and deserved for one of his better performances. Great ‘dink’ from max clark though, and good too from masterton to low cross in the box.

Glenn Morris was super in goal. I like Jake a lot, but do wonder if a little rest may do him good. In fact, the old adage -why change a winning team. I think he made a great double save second half. But will have to see it again to be sure.

When the subs came I thought Max Clark was unlucky to get hooked. He is enjoying a run of games and had a hand in the goal too. Nadesan (although wasn’t a goal threat, as usual) also worked hard. And Jayden Clarke came on for him. Was a good tactical sub I thought. Stretch the game, give the Wrexham defence something to think about. However he frustrated me more in 15 mins 5han Nadesan did in the previous 75ish mins. On more than one occasion he could’ve shown a bit more of the pacewe know he has to break through.

The crowd (particularly Rainham End, obvs) were fantastic. Was probably the best atmosphere of the season.

All in all, 4 points from top and third in week. A great return. Which obviously frustrates us all to the point of fucking madness! We can be so fucking resilient and tenatious with flashes of quality when needed. Why can’t we do it more regularly.
